Hi !

 

Some week´s ago i reported that my Disksation stops without  any reason.

 

I was not shure if ti was EMBY or my Diskstation.

 

Now after install Emby on an brand new Diskstation i am shure :-)

 

Emby stops without a reason.

 

EMby Server Version 3.5.3.0 

Diskstation DSM 6.2.1-23824 Update 2

Model DS1817+

 

When i look in the apps center Emby is on stop. After i restart emby it works fine.
